About this program

The PhD program in Transportation Engineering at Rensselaer Polytechnic Institute focuses on advanced concepts in transportation systems, policy development, logistics, and planning. The curriculum is designed to equip students with the necessary knowledge and skills to tackle complex transportation problems and devise effective solutions. Students will engage in rigorous research that encompasses various aspects of transportation engineering, including traffic flow theory, transportation safety, and sustainable infrastructure.

This doctoral program typically involves a combination of coursework, research projects, and a dissertation, allowing students to specialize in areas such as smart transportation systems and transportation network modeling. Through collaboration with faculty and industry professionals, students gain hands-on experience that complements their academic learning, fostering critical thinking and innovation.

Additionally, the program emphasizes the development of analytical and technical skills through workshops and seminars. Graduates will emerge as leaders in the field, equipped to influence real-world policies and practices in transportation engineering. Entry requirements

To be considered for admission to the PhD program in Transportation Engineering, candidates typically need a master's degree in civil engineering or a closely related field. Strong academic performance in undergraduate and graduate coursework, particularly in mathematics and engineering sciences, is essential. Relevant research experience and a statement of purpose demonstrating interest and alignment with faculty research areas are also required.

English:

International applicants are usually required to demonstrate proficiency in English through standardized tests such as TOEFL or IELTS. Typically, a minimum TOEFL score of 90 (iBT) or an IELTS score of 7.0 is expected, but higher scores are often preferred.

International students:

International students must obtain an F-1 visa for study in the United States. Upon acceptance, the university will provide the necessary documents (I-20) to apply for the visa. Students must also adhere to SEVIS regulations during their studies.
